Meta is advancing custom MTIA silicon, planning to deploy MTIA 450 (Arke) in H1 2027 and MTIA 500 (Astrid) by end-2027. These target efficient inference workloads with better performance-per-watt and cost than Nvidia systems. Meta partnered with Broadcom and TSMC.

Google DeepMind announced Gemini 3.8 Live, a native speech-to-speech model with low-latency voice interactions, and Extended Thinking for complex multi-step reasoning. Both support visual context, multilingual switching, and agentic workflows available via Gemini API and Google AI Studio.

Microsoft revealed a San Francisco event on how local AI will shape the PC, featuring CEO Satya Nadella, Windows chief Pavan Davuluri, and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ang. Expectations include Windows improvements, new Surface devices with NPU capabilities for local AI, and Arm/Windows progress.
